The Design of Instrument for the Level and Label of Gasoline Measurement Based on AT89C52

Article Preview

Abstract:

A measuring circuit of the level and the label of the oil is concered in this paper.A combinatorial sensor is designed to calculate the liquid level and the dielectric constant at the same time. The calculation is achived by using AT89C52. In the process of the calculation ,arithmetic mean filtering and least-squares method are used to improve the accuracy .The circuit of this system is simple, low power consumption and suitable for using in portable measurement devices.
